The short holiday is coming soon, so here is some essential knowledge for a 26-day trip to South America, where you can enjoy the beautiful lakes and mountains, and unlock the mysterious and wild South America throughout the trip! No need to ask, just look ~ to help you enjoy the rich exotic customs! / 🌍Itinerary: DAY1-DAY3: Fly to Sao Paulo, Brazil, and take a bus into the city to enjoy the South American scenery. DAY4-DAY12: First go to Lima to explore the city, then fly to Iquitos for adventure, and then return to Lima for sightseeing. Then fly to Urubamba, immerse yourself in the Inca culture, and visit Machu Picchu and Cusco. Then we’ll spend 6 hours on the journey to the Huacachina Oasis, explore the Pisco and Paracas National Reserves, and finally return to Lima to fly over Santiago. DAY13-DAY15: Experience the seaside life in Santiago, go to a winery for wine tasting, and then fly to Rio de Janeiro to experience the frenzy of South America. DAY16-26: Fly from Rio de Janeiro to Foz do Iguaçu and experience the impressive Iguaçu Falls. Then fly to Buenos Aires to Colonia (Uruguay). Return to Ushuaia via Buenos Aires. Waterfalls, green plants, and wild animals are all natural beauties that you must visit once in your lifetime. / 📱First part: First of all, you definitely need to bring a phone card and a plug converter. The power plugs in South America may be different from what we are used to, so it is essential to carry a universal plug converter. As for phone cards, it is recommended to purchase them locally for Internet access and communication. 📂Part 2: Necessary items for certificates. First of all, a passport, and of course, don’t forget that you’ll also need a visa for South America! Then there is travel insurance, which will provide you with strong protection in case of any unexpected events during your trip. 🧥Part 3: March in South America is autumn, so clothing should be comfortable and warm. Of course, you are going to the rainforest and plateau in South America, so waterproof jackets and thermal underwear are essential. Don't forget to bring your sun hat and sunglasses because South America is near the equator and the sun is very strong. 🔌Part 4: When you go out, it is important to protect your electronic devices. It's also a good idea to bring chargers for your camera and phone, and a portable battery. This way you don't have to worry about finding an outlet. / This is the beauty of South America.
